Who We Are

Founded in 2005, 2K Games is a global video game company, publishing titles developed by some of the most influential game development studios in the world. Our studio is responsible for developing 2K’s portfolio of world-class games across multiple platforms, including Visual Concepts, Firaxis, Hangar 13, Cat Daddy, Cloud Chamber, and HB Studios. Our portfolio of titles is expanding due to our global strategic plan, building, and acquiring exciting studios whose content continues to inspire all of us! 2K publishes titles in today’s most popular gaming genres, including sports, shooters, action, role-playing, strategy, casual, and family entertainment.

Our team of engineers, marketers, artists, writers, data scientists, producers, thinkers, and doers, are the professional publishing stewards of our growing library of critically acclaimed franchises such as NBA 2K, Battleborn, BioShock, Borderlands, The Darkness, Mafia, Sid Meier’s Civilization, WWE 2K, and XCOM.

What We Need

Reporting to the Manager, Global Product Marketing—and supporting the full Global Brand and Product Marketing team—the Associate Manager will play a key role in supporting the planning and execution of the NBA 2K Product Marketing strategy.

This role is primarily responsible for delivering compelling content and campaigns that motivate players to engage with NBA 2K. This includes creating and delivering content against key moments in the player’s journey by leveraging behavioral insights, transactional data, creative storytelling, as well as automation tools to deliver timely, relevant, and high-impact messaging content, at scale.

We’re looking for someone who understands the NBA 2K experience from the inside out—especially MyCAREER—and is excited by the opportunity to help facilitate how millions of players experience the game each Season. This role requires someone who can pivot quickly, take initiative, and bring strong attention to detail while operating in a highly collaborative, cross-functional environment.

The Associate Manager will be part of a team that values innovation, player connection and drives product marketing strategy. Building strong relationships both within and across teams is essential to success in this role. You’ll work closely with the Manager, Product Marketing to stay aligned, prioritize effectively, and help bring ideas to life through true cross-functional collaboration.

We’re committed to delivering personal, relevant, and timely content to our NBA 2K players—and we’re looking for someone who shares that passion. The right person will bring ideas to the table, big or small, and help turn them into real in and out of game moments. We value someone who is willing to contribute thoughtfully, ask the right questions, and bring energy and intention to everything they do.

What You Will Do
  • Support and execute always-on MyCAREER marketing with a focus on driving player engagement throughout the lifecycle through awareness and retention campaigns. 

  • Manage Season Pass creative briefing, marketing execution and digital setup throughout products lifecycle—optimizing and driving increased adoption and sustained engagement.

  • Collaborate with various teams within the 2K publishing and marketing organization to communicate, organize, and share content plans promptly, maintaining the Product Marketing calendar and other project management tools to keep teams informed.

  • Partner with marketing channel leads and creative producers to develop briefs and ensure assets are delivered on time and aligned with campaign goals across owned, paid, and earned marketing channels.

  • Assist in managing Product Marketing content delivery operations including in-game content campaigns and associated creative assets across channels such as Push Notifications, In-Game, CRM, and Social.

  • Review, provide feedback, and approve creative materials supporting campaigns to enhance engagement across key game modes.

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
